WebAug 4, 2024 · Two aspects of the formal training that may have contributed to positive patient perceptions were (1) the appropriate use of silence by clinicians (ie, after delivering prognosis) and (2) limiting clinician speaking time to less than 50% of the conversation. Patients mentioned an increased understanding of their prognosis and disease trajectory. WebCOVID-19 infection may require their goals of care to be rapidly reassessed. This involves holding a serious illness conversation (SIC). The SIC should be a detailed exploration of the patient’s understanding of their illness and their hopes, fears, goals, and values. Fraser Health recommend following the steps below.
